Arshad Warsi and Jitendra Kumar Face Off in Thrilling Crime Drama Bhagwat: First Look Revealed.

Arshad Warsi and Jitendra Kumar are set to star in the upcoming crime thriller "Bhagwat," a ZEE5 original film inspired by true events. Produced by Jio Studios in association with Baweja Studios and Dog 'n' Bone Pictures, the film is directed by Akshay Shere.

The film centers around Inspector Vishwas Bhagwat (Arshad Warsi), who gets involved in a missing woman's case that appears routine at first. However, the investigation soon leads him into a complex web of deceit, secrets, and suspected trafficking. Amidst the suspense, a romance develops between Meera and Sameer (Jitendra Kumar), a professor, adding an unexpected layer of vulnerability to the narrative and contrasting with the tension of the main plot.

ZEE5 recently unveiled a motion poster for "Bhagwat" with the caption: "And we thought all the plot twists of 2025 were over, but the biggest one is here… Bhagwat is coming to blow your mind". The film promises to be a dark, twist-filled ride rooted in realism.

Arshad Warsi, fresh off the buzz from "Jolly LLB 3," takes on a darker, more dramatic role, which is a return to the complex characters that fans have loved him for. Jitendra Kumar, known for his relatable role in "Panchayat," will be seen in a more intense avatar, marking a departure from his usual comedic roles.

The ensemble cast of "Bhagwat" includes Ayesha Kanga, Tara Alisha Berry, and Rashmi Rajput, suggesting a layered narrative with multiple perspectives. The film is set against the backdrop of Robertsganj, Uttar Pradesh, blending mystery, emotion, and drama.

Kaveri Das, Business Head, Hindi, ZEE5, said that "Bhagwat" is a gripping thriller that's emotionally layered and suspenseful. She added that Arshad Warsi brings depth to his character, and Jitendra Kumar breaks new ground in a surprising avatar. According to reports from April 2023, Arshad Warsi and Jitendra Kumar have already wrapped up shooting for the film, which mainly took place in Uttar Pradesh.

"Bhagwat" is produced by Harman Baweja, who has also produced films like "Yeh Kya Ho Raha Hai?" and "Honeymoon". Akshay Shere, the director, has previously worked as an assistant director on Hindi films like "Sarkar" and "Darna Zaroori Hai". Mangesh Dhakde is the music director, and Hemal Kothari is the editor.
